Overview

Foundations of Mathematics provides the essential language and logical framework upon which all mathematical disciplines are built. It introduces students to the precise way mathematicians think—through definitions, logical deductions, and structured reasoning. Topics such as sets, relations, functions, and logic form the backbone of this subject.

This course is not about computation but about clarity of thought. It trains students to distinguish between intuition and rigor, enabling them to understand why mathematical statements are true. A strong foundation here ensures success in advanced areas such as analysis, algebra, and topology.
